Improving Hospital Operations with RFID Asset Tracking

Hospitals are intricate environments where efficient operations are paramount. Managing medical supplies is a vital aspect of guaranteeing quality patient care. RFID asset tracking offers a cutting-edge solution to optimize hospital operations and improve overall workflow.

RFID technology employs radio frequency identification tags attached to medical assets. These tags transmit unique identifiers that can be scanned by RFID readers. This dynamic tracking capability provides a in-depth view of the status of medical assets throughout the hospital.

Improving Inventory Management with RFID in Healthcare

In the fast-paced and demanding environment of healthcare, optimal inventory management is crucial for providing timely patient care. Radio-frequency identification (RFID) technology has emerged as a transformative solution to enhance this process. RFID tags, attached to medical supplies and equipment, allow for real-time tracking and monitoring of inventory levels. This provides numerous benefits, including minimizing waste, enhancing order accuracy, and accelerating staff efficiency.

  • Employing RFID for inventory management in healthcare settings can lead to significant cost savings by minimizing losses due to expiration or theft.
  • Additionally, real-time visibility into inventory levels allows for preventive reordering, ensuring that essential supplies are always on hand.

By adopting RFID technology, healthcare institutions can transform their inventory management processes, leading to improved patient outcomes, reduced costs, and enhanced operational efficiency.

Optimize Medical Equipment with RFID Tracking

In the realm of healthcare, optimizing medical equipment is paramount. Lost or misplaced instruments can disrupt patient RFID Tracking in Hospitals care and substantially impact operational costs. Fortunately, a cutting-edge solution has emerged to address this challenge: RFID (Radio-Frequency Identification) tracking.

By leveraging RFID technology, healthcare hospitals can immediate track the location of each piece of medical equipment within their complex.

RFID tags are integrated with medical devices, allowing them to be tracked via RFID readers. This system provides a comprehensive audit trail of equipment movements, optimizing inventory management and reducing loss or theft.

  • Furthermore, RFID tracking can facilitate timely maintenance by sending alerts when equipment requires servicing.
  • Moreover, it optimizes sterilization processes by monitoring the location and status of sterilized instruments.

Enhancing Medication Traceability and Security with RFID

RFID technology is revolutionizing the pharmaceutical industry by offering a robust solution for medication traceability and security. Integrated RFID tags allow real-time tracking of pharmaceuticals throughout the supply chain, from producers to healthcare facilities. This enhanced visibility reduces the risk of copyright medications and strengthens patient safety. By implementing RFID, pharmaceutical companies can ensure the authenticity and integrity of medicines, finally improving medication security and public health.
